The part " d6 + i " threw me off track there, so I am going to assume that the question asks us to find the distance between 2 - 4i and 6 + i. This can be determined through a simple " distance formula, " as shown in the attachment below,


d = √(( 6 - 2 )^2 + ( 1 - ( - 4 )^2),\\d = √(( 4)^2 +( 5 )^2),\\d = √(41)

The distance is √41!
